WebTill, Add Landscape Mulch And Fabrics. In order for goat head seeds to actually sprout, they have to have 1-2 inches of soil. To stop them from sprouting, you should till the soil around 6 inches deep. This way you are burying any seeds deep in the soil so they will have a hard time trying to germinate. WebOct 1, 2008 · Tetanus prophylaxis is indicated. For very young goats, castration is similar to calf castration. The distal one third of the scrotum is removed with a scalpel. Each testicle is stripped from the scrotal fascia and pulled ventrally to tear the spermatic cord. The incision is left open to drain and heal by second intention. WebThe key to eradicating goatheads is killing the plants before they form and drop thorns. Early detection and aggressive removal works. Mix 1/2 cup of Epsom salts and 1/2 cup of white vinegar in a gallon of water. Pour over the plants so that it saturates the ground. To get rid of a goathead weed, pull the entire plant slowly from its taproot before it starts producing seeds.
